Anatomy of Melody, The
by Alice Parker
2006 GIA Publications, Inc.
In an effort to reawaken our intrinsic desire to hear a beautiful, sweeping musical phrase, Alice Parker introduces what may become the most important work on melody to date. Artfully written and infused with her passion for music, The Anatomy of Melody endeavors to take us back to the very basis of song. This book explores the history of melody and its elements regional differences in performance, and each tune’s primary function in music and in our lives. The Anatomy of Melody provides copious examples of some of the most beloved and well-known melodies of the Western world. The sage words of Alice Parker resonate with the importance of this work: “When our ears and voices connect in song, it makes possible a transcendental moment that releases us from our human limitations. Let’s find our way to melody again.”
